#0d1344 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0d1344 is composed of 5.1% red, 7.5%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.9% cyan, 72.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 73.3% black. It has a hue angle of 233.5 degrees, a saturation of 67.9% and a lightness of 15.9%. #0d1344 color hex could be obtained by blending #1a2688 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

Shades and Tints of #0d1344
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#f1f2f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#0d1344
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#26262b is the less saturated color, while #010950 is the most saturated one.
